Project Type Typical Range
Water Softening System Installation $1,200 - $2,800
Reverse Osmosis System Replacement $1,500 - $3,000
Whole House Filtration System $4,500 - $8,000
Water Testing and Assessment $300 - $700
UV Water Purification System $2,000 - $4,000
Water Softener Maintenance $150 - $400

Key Cost Factors

Water treatment services in Upper Marlboro, MD, encompass a range of solutions to improve water quality for residential and commercial properties. These projects can vary based on the scope of work, materials used, and local permitting requirements. Understanding typical project components can help in comparing options and estimating costs.

  • Materials: Selection of filtration media, softening resins, or reverse osmosis membranes depends on water quality and treatment goals.
  • Size and Scope: Projects range from small point-of-use filters to whole-house systems, affecting equipment size and installation complexity.
  • Labor Complexity: Installation may involve plumbing modifications, electrical work, and system integration, influencing labor requirements.
  • Permitting: Certain water treatment upgrades may require local permits or inspections to comply with municipal regulations.
  • Additional Options: Optional features such as UV sterilizers, mineral additions, or water softener upgrades can be included for enhanced water quality.
